Eureka Country Club is an 18-hole golf course in Eureka, KS with a par of 72. It offers 2 tee sets: white/blue (6,207 yards, slope 121, rating 70.1), green/silver (5,446 yards, slope 111, rating 65.8). The hardest hole is #4, a par 4 playing 390 yards from the first tee.
